About Vijayendra Kumar

Vijayendra Kumar is a scholar working on Surgery, Organic Chemistry,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Urology and Molecular Biology, having authored 61 papers that have together received 643 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Esophageal and GI Pathology (7 papers), Gastrointestinal disorders and treatments (6 papers), Urological Disorders and Treatments (6 papers), Congenital gastrointestinal and neural anomalies (6 papers), Congenital Anomalies and Fetal Surgery (5 papers), Intestinal Malrotation and Obstruction Disorders (5 papers), Pediatric Hepatobiliary Diseases and Treatments (4 papers) and Streptococcal Infections and Treatments (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Surgery (288 citations), Urology (31 citations), Organic Chemistry (146 citations), Toxicology (9 citations) and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(70 citations). Vijayendra Kumar has collaborated with scholars based in India, United States and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include SP Sharma, Anand Pandey, Dinesh Gupta, Virinder S. Parmar, Ajay Narayan Gangopadhyay, S. Chooramani Gopal, Carl Erik Olsen, Ashok K. Prasad, Subhash C. Jain and Hanumantharao G. Raj.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Macromolecular Science Part A, Pediatric Surgery International, Bioorganic & Medicinal Chemistry, International Wound Journal and World Journal of Surgery.
